Disclosed herein are a cocoon-based artificial biomembrane and a method for manufacturing the same. A cocoon the shell of which has a first thickness is divided into two or more fragments in a predetermined form. The cocoon fragments may be used as artificial biomembranes. They can be relatively simply manufactured in a more cost efficient manner than conventional artificial biomembranes and have excellent cell growth potential. Also contemplated are a cocoon-based artificial biomembrane having excellent tensile strength and elongation, and a method for manufacturing the same.

Provided is a device for collecting mulberries, which is easy to install and disassemble while being manufactured with a low cost, and is able to help the growth of a fruit. The device for collecting mulberries includes: a net which is radially stretched out around a tree at a lower part of mulberries; a collection guiding unit which is installed in a center part of the net and guides falling mulberries to any one side; and a collecting bag which contains the mulberries guided from the collection guiding unit, wherein the collection guiding unit has a disk shape and is installed to be eccentric to a center of the net at any one side, so as to be slanted downwards to a slanted opposite side.

The present invention relates to a method for preparing germinated soy germ by germinating soy germ separated from soybeans. In particular, the method of the present invention includes the steps of: drying soybeans as a raw material in a hot-air dryer at 35℃ for 72 hours so as to efficiently isolate seed coats, cotyledons and soy germ from the soybeans; pulverizing the dried soybean seeds using a peeler; separating soy germ from the pulverized soybean seeds using a series of sieves having a sieve opening of 2.36 mm, 2.0 mm and 1.18 mm; putting the separated soy germ into a mesh bag having a size of 40 × 50 cm and inducing the germination thereof using running water at about 20℃ for 20 to 24 hours; harvesting the germinated soy germ with improvement in nutritional ingredients and cooking them with steam for 20 minutes; and freeze-drying or hot-air drying the steamed soy germ. The germinated soy germ prepared according to the method of the present invention can be effectively used as functional, industrial and medical materials as well as a raw material for various foods. Further, the method of the present invention is effective to improve the usefulness of soybeans that are Korean traditional food materials and increase the applicability thereof as a new food material being helpful to the improvement in national public health.

Provided is a method of collecting wild termites and rearing the termites indoors. The method can be used to observe physiological and ecological characteristics of termites that give serious damage to wooden cultural assets and buildings, and thus basic information can be obtained for controlling termites.

Provided are a method of producing a waxy rice cake that is not hardened for shelf-life, including: (a) immersing waxy rice in water and removing the water therefrom; (b) first steaming the waxy rice from which water is removed; (c) adding salt and water to the first steamed waxy rice, followed by second steaming; and (d) cooling the second steamed waxy rice and adding flour thereto, followed by punching, a waxy rice cake produced by using the method, and a processed food produced by processing the waxy rice cake. The waxy rice cake has longer storage duration than a conventional waxy rice cake and due to the long storage duration, the waxy rice cake can be distributed for shelf-life according to storage conditions. Also, the waxy rice cake retains its chewy texture and thus is suitable for consumers' tastes.

The present invention relates to a biodegradable, photo-degradable biofilm comprising rice hull and rice bran, and a method of its preparation. More particularly, the present presentation relates to a biodegradable, photo-degradable biofilm comprising rice hull and rice bran, starch, titanium dioxide and biodegradable polyester, which enables to retain a suitable strength to protect crops during their growth, thus being capable of reducing the cost normally required for collecting the leftover films used for covering field during cultivation and the handling cost thereof.

The present invention relates to expression vectors and methods for enhancing soluble expression and secretion of a heterologous protein, particularly a bulky folded active heterologous protein which has one or more transmembrane-like domains or intramolecular disulfide bonds by linking a leader peptide with acidic or basic pI and high hydrophilicity thereto; by substituting one or more amino acids within N-terminal of the heterologous protein with ones having acidic or neutral pI and high hydrophilicity; or reducing elevating G RNA value of a polynucleotide encoding the leader peptide having basic pI value and high hydrophilicity. The expression vector and the method may be used to produce of heterologous protein and to transduce of therapeutic proteins in a patient by preventing formation of insoluble inclusion body and by enhancing secretional efficiency of the heterologous protein into the periplasm or outside cell.

The present invention relates to a method for seal forgery inspection comprising: a step (ST-101) of generating (ST-110) a reference seal from an original seal; and a step (ST-121) of comparing the reference seal generated in step (ST-101) and a comparative seal, and calculating (ST-140) a characteristic value of the comparative seal relative to the reference seal. As indicated by the result of an experiment, a seal forged by a fake stamp produced by computer-aided manufacturing can be distinguished, as well as a seal forged by a fake stamp produced by etching a zinc plate or a resin plate. The present invention proposes an objective basis for judging whether or not seals on a document or the like are forged during the processing of civil or criminal cases, thereby preventing errors which might be caused in conventional judging methods using the naked eye or microscopic analysis.

The present invention provides a method for producing Phellinus linteus extract, comprising the steps of drying and grinding Phellinus linteus to obtain powder thereof, and I) adding to the powder less than a 15-fold excess of water, relative to the weight of the Phellinus linteus powder, and extracting Phellinus linteus extract therefrom at a temperature of 100°C for 5 hours; or ii) adding to the powder less than a 15-fold excess of water, relative to the weight of the Phellinus linteus powder, and extracting Phellinus linteus extract therefrom at a boiling point of 121°C for 1 hour under pressure of 15 lbs (1 kg/cm 2 ); or iii) adding to the powder less than a 15-fold excess of 50 to 75% aqueous ethanol or methanol solution, relative to the weight of the Phellinus linteus powder, and extracting Phellinu s linteus extract therefrom at a temperature of 60°C for 5 hours. Further, the present invention provides a food composition comprising the Phellinus linteus extract obtained by the same method.
